These days, no one stays in one workplace for 25 years. Unless, of course, they really want to. And apparently 14 Ebby Halliday and Dave Perry-Miller Real Estate agents really want to.

On Wednesday, September 21, these seasoned real estate professionals gathered along with sales leaders and home office executives, at Al Biernat’s North in Addison for a special celebratory lunch. Last year, the Ebby Halliday Companies fêted 43 such 25-year anniversaries, so the ranks just keep swelling.

As they raised a glass, Ebby Halliday Companies President Carolyn Rosson praised the recipients in her remarks.

“You all lead the culture,” she said. “You are the reason other agents want to join our firm. It’s because of you, the way you serve your clients and the way that you do business. So thank you, thank you, thank you.”

As for why someone may stay at the Ebby Halliday Companies so long, DPMRE Lakewood agent Susan Nelson Wheeler provided a bit of insight. 

“I started at Ebby Halliday a long time ago,” she said. “I get a lot of offers to come with other companies and I always tell them, ‘I’m not leaving. There’s no reason to leave.’ They support us in every way. They’re always thinking of new ways they can do things to make our lives easier.” 

About his decision to join from another brokerage 25 years prior, Ebby Southwest Dallas | Ellis Co. agent Greg Hutchinson added, “I think the thing that made the difference with Ebby was the reputation of the company. The fact that when I went into somebody’s home to discuss the sale of their house, I had that company name behind me and that carried a lot of weight. They may not have known me from Adam, but they certainly knew the name Ebby Halliday.”

Senior Vice President, Brokerage Malinda Howell summed up the overall vibe of the occasion by saying, “This is an iconic company with iconic people. I think you are all living out our mission of ‘People First,’ and we are so honored to continue to have you. That doesn’t mean you can go anywhere — you’ve got 25 more years here. Who’s in?”
